Overview

The Pedrollo QEM and QET series are control boxes designed for 4" borehole pumps, manufactured in Italy. These control boxes are essential components for managing the operation of submersible pumps, ensuring their efficient and safe functioning. They are built to meet high-quality and environmental standards, being certified by DNV for both ISO 14001 (environmental system) and ISO 9001 (quality system).

Function Description:

The primary function of the QEM and QET control boxes is to provide a centralized control point for borehole pumps. They manage the pump's power supply, offer protection against various electrical faults, and allow for manual or automatic operation. The QEM series is designed for single-phase pumps, while the QET series caters to three-phase pumps. Both series incorporate features to safeguard the pump motor from overcurrents and thermal overloads, thereby extending the pump's lifespan and ensuring reliable operation. They also include inputs for external control devices such as float switches or pressure switches, enabling automated pump control based on water levels or system pressure.

Important Technical Specifications:

QEM Series (Single-Phase):

  • Power Supply: 1~50/60 Hz, 230V ±10%.
  • Main Switch: ON/OFF.
  • Motor Overcurrent Protection: Included.
  • Luminous Indicators: Green LED for "Motor active (ON)".
  • Inputs: For float / pressure switch.
  • Fuses: With aM tripping curve.
  • Enclosure: ABS box, IP55 rated.
  • Ambient Temperature: -5°C to +40°C.
  • Relative Humidity: 50% at 40°C (condensate free).

QET Series (Three-Phase):

  • Power Supply: 3~50/60 Hz, 400V ±10%.
  • Main Switch: MANUAL/OFF/AUTOMATIC.
  • Motor Overcurrent Protection: Included.
  • Luminous Indicators: Green LED for "Motor active (ON)", Red LED for "Thermal relay protection active".
  • Inputs: For float / pressure switch.
  • Fuses: With aM tripping curve.
  • Enclosure: ABS box, IP55 rated.
  • Ambient Temperature: -5°C to +40°C.
  • Relative Humidity: 50% at 40°C (condensate free).

Both control boxes are designed for indoor installation in a well-ventilated environment. They comply with several EU directives and technical standards, including 73/23/CEE, 93/68/CEE, CEI 17-13/1 (EN 60439-1), CEI 70-1 (EN 60529), CEI 44-5 (EN 60204-1), and EN 60335-1/95, ensuring their safety and performance in accordance with European regulations.

Usage Features:

QEM Series:

Operation is straightforward. Turning the main switch to position (1) starts the pump, indicated by the green LED illuminating. The pump continues to operate until the switch is turned to position (0). In case of a motor overload, the thermal protection activates, stopping the pump and turning off the green LED. The intervention is signaled by the thermal protection button dropping out. To restore operation, the user must press the reset button down.

QET Series:

The QET offers more versatile control with its MANUAL/OFF/AUTOMATIC main switch.

  • MANUAL (MAN) Position: Starts the pump in manual mode, with the green LED indicating the pump is running. The pump operates continuously until the switch is moved to the (0) position.
  • AUTOMATIC (AUT) Position: Activates the pump only when the contact wired to the P-P terminals (e.g., from a float or pressure switch) is closed. The pump runs as long as the P-P contact remains closed or until the main switch is turned to (0).
  • Overload Protection: An amperometric relay stops the pump during motor overload, turning off the green LED and illuminating the red LED to indicate tripping. To reset, the main switch must be turned to (0), the control box opened, and the RESET button pressed down. An automatic reset feature can be enabled by pressing and turning the reset button ¼ turn clockwise, though this is not recommended.

Installation:

Proper installation is crucial for the safe and effective operation of these control boxes.

  • Power Supply Verification: Ensure the main power supply voltage matches the specifications on the control panel's data plate and the connected motor.
  • Earthing: A robust earthing connection must be established before any other connections are made.
  • Residual Current Circuit Breaker: The power line must be protected by a residual current circuit breaker.
  • Wiring: Electrical cables should be tightened securely to their terminals using appropriate tools to prevent damage to the fixing screws. Care should be taken when using electric screwdrivers.
  • Environment: Install the equipment away from heat sources, in a dry, sheltered location, respecting the stated IP55 protection rating.
  • Safety Device: Installation of a safety device to protect the panel power line is recommended, in compliance with current electrical standards.
  • Qualified Electrician: All installation operations must be performed by a qualified electrician familiar with current safety standards.
  • Initial Check: After connection, verify the settings of the electrical panel, as the pump may start automatically.

Maintenance Features:

The Pedrollo QEM/QET control boxes are designed for reliability and generally do not require routine maintenance, provided they are used within their specified operating limits and according to the manual's instructions.

  • Specialized Maintenance: Any special maintenance or repairs must be carried out exclusively by authorized service centers.
  • Original Spare Parts: In the event of repairs, only original spare parts should be used to ensure continued performance and safety. The manufacturer disclaims liability for damage or injury resulting from unauthorized personnel performing maintenance or using non-original materials.
  • Storage: If the control box is not used for extended periods, it should be stored in a clean, safe location, protected from atmospheric agents and potential physical damage.
  • Fire Safety: In case of fire, avoid using water jets. Instead, use appropriate extinguishing agents such as powder, foam, or carbon dioxide.
  • Disposal: When the product reaches the end of its life, disassembly and scrapping must adhere strictly to local legislation regarding pollution. Waste disposal according to material categories is recommended.

Safety Warnings:

The manual emphasizes several critical safety warnings:

  • DANGER: Indicates a risk of death, severe injury, or damage to goods. Instructions under this sign must be followed carefully.
  • CAUTION: Also indicates a risk of death, severe injury, or damage to goods, requiring careful attention.
  • WARNING: Instructions under this sign must be followed to prevent equipment malfunction, damage, and injury to personnel.
  • Power Disconnection: Always cut off the power supply before working on the electrical panel or system.
  • Earthing: Connect to an efficient earthing system before any other work.
  • Automatic Start: Be aware that the electrical pump may start automatically after the system is connected and settings are checked.
  • Qualified Personnel: All installation and maintenance operations must be performed by a specialized technician fully aware of current safety standards.
  • Intended Use: The QEM/QET panels must be used exclusively for their specified design purpose. Any other application is considered improper and hazardous.
